Doctors who listen to Mozart while carrying out a colonoscopy may improve their detection rates of precancerous polyps, according to new research.
The study found that adenoma detection rates increased from baseline values with music compared to without for two endoscopists whose baseline adenoma detection rates were calculated over a one-year period prior to the start of the study.
Scientists looked at two endoscopists, one of whom was blinded to the outcome and had an adenoma detection rate of 36.7 per cent with Mozart compared to 30.4 per cent without the music.
The other doctor, who was unblinded to the outcome, was seen to have a detection rate of 36.7 per cent with Mozart and 40.5 per cent without the music.
Dr O'Shea said: "Anything we can do get those rates up has the potential to save lives. While this is a small study, the results highlight how thinking outside the box - in this case using Mozart - to improve adenoma detection rates can potentially prove valuable to physicians and patients."
Adenomas are a type of colon polyp that is thought to be a precursor for invasive colorectal cancer.
